Hi guys, I'm in need of some real help here.

I recently rebuilt my computer with the parts in my sig. Everything is looking fine, but I simply cannot managed to get XP to boot so I can install it.

In the BIOS, I've got it set to boot from my DVD drives. Windows XP is in the drive (I've tried both). I restart, and instead of the screen that says "Click here to load from CD...", I get this message:

Reboot and Select proper boot device or insert Boot Media in select boot device and press a key.


Well, I've got the correct drives selected as my boot device, and the boot media is definitely in the drive.

I'm using Liteon DVD burners, connected via IDE. The jumpers in the back of the drives are set correctly for slave and master, and the drives are properly listed under the boot device menu in the BIOS.


Is there some setting I'm missing? I've looked thru the manual to no avail. I'm just tinkering around trying to get something to work...so far no luck. Any thoughts? This is getting frustrating!
